Headquartered in Grapevine, Texas, GameStop 4,816 stores in a number of countries. Namely, it has 3,192 stores in the United States, 253 stores in Canada, and 417 stores in Australia and New Zealand. Additionally, the company also operates 954 stores in Europe. It runs not only GameStop stores, but also owns such brands like Zing Pop Culture, ThinkGeek, Micromania-Zing, EB Games Australia, and EB Games.

About Company

In fact, the company’s roots can be traced back to 1984, when Babbage’s, a software retailer based in Texas, was founded. In the following decades, the company went through certain periods under various names, such as NeoStar Retail Group and Babbage’s Etc.

In 1999, Barnes and Noble purchased Babbage’s for $215 million. While being a subsidiary of this retail giant, Babbage’s eventually became a subsidiary of FuncoLand, another video game retailer owned by Barnes & Noble. Eventually, Funco was renamed into GameStop.

In 2004, however, Barnes & Noble released a 59% stake it had in GameStop, thus making it independent again. That’s how the successful years for the company began. During the period from 2004 to 2016, the number of GameStop stores grew to over 5,000 locations worldwide.

Today, there are 4,816 GameStop stores in several countries, though the majority of the locations are scattered across the United States. The company also owns a number of subsidiaries, such as Babbage’s, EB Games, Geeknet, Game Informer, Micromania-Zing, ThinkGeek, Rhino Video Games, Zing Marketplace, and Zing Pop Culture Australia. Currently, more than 12,000 employees work for the company, while almost 20,000 are employed part-time.
